Punta Cana, DR.- Frank Elías Rainieri, CEO of Grupo Puntacana, showcased the progress of the first aircraft maintenance center in the region, a collaboration with FL Technics at Punta Cana International Airport (PUJ). The facility will serve as a hub for the maintenance, repair, and overhaul (MRO) of various commercial aircraft.

Strategically located in the Punta Cana Free Trade Zone, the MRO area will span 115,588 m² of land and 27,000 m² of constructed space. The center will initially feature five maintenance bays for narrow-body aircraft, with plans for expansion to 12 bays. The project is expected to generate around 1,600 jobs, with more than 500 young engineers working on-site.

Upon completion of the first phase, the facility will include five hangars for on-site maintenance, along with a full support workshop. This project aligns with FL Technics’ global expansion, adding to its existing network of hangars in Europe and Asia-Pacific.
